Elite boot lid "Push Here To Close" label
Anyone out there know the font used and layout of the "PRESS HERE TO CLOSE" label on the rear hatch of a 1974 elite. I have enough visible to see some of the letters, and it looks like the background was originally silver with black letter. I measure the label at 24mm x 20mm. Beyond that, I don't ha...
